There are two types of Peugeot 508 fog lights, namely halogen and LED fog lights.
Peugeot 508 Halogen Fog Light:
Halogen fog lights get their power from halogen bulbs. A halogen bulb contains a tungsten filament and also halogen gas. The tungsten filament works like a conductor and heats up when current passes through it. The heat makes the filament glow brightly. When one of the two electrodes in the bulb breaks, it can no longer power the light. These halogen fog lights are affordable and easy to replace. However, the light they produce is not as bright as LED lights. Also, because they use a lot of power, they are not very energy efficient.
Peugeot 508 Led Fog Light:
LED fog lights are different from halogen fog lights because they don't use a filament to produce light. Instead, they have tiny chips inside called semiconductors that emit light when current passes through them. There are two main advantages of LED fog lights. First, they shine brighter than halogen fog lights. Secondly, they are energy efficient. They use less power and can run for a longer time on a battery. However, LED fog lights are more expensive than halogen fog lights.
There are several things to consider regarding the maintenance and specification of the Peugeot 508 fog light.
Bulb Type:
The bulbs used for the Peugeot 508 fog lights vary depending on the trim level and model year. For instance, some may use halogen bulbs, such as H11 bulbs, while others may come with LED or HID (High-Intensity Discharge) lights. So, it is essential to check the specific trim level and model year to find the exact bulb type.
Wattage:
For halogen fog light bulbs, the wattage is typically around 55 watts. LED fog lights, on the other hand, consume less power, usually around 20-30 watts per bulb, but they are much brighter and more efficient than halogen bulbs.
Color Temperature:
Color temperature is an essential specification to consider when buying fog lights. It is measured in Kelvin (K) and determines the color of the light produced by the bulbs. Fog lights with higher color temperatures (such as 6000K-6500K) emit a bright white light, similar to daylight. On the other hand, fog lights with lower color temperatures (such as 3000K-4000K) emit a yellowish or warm white light.
Lumens:
Fog lights are not as bright as headlights because they are designed to illuminate the road just a few feet in front of the vehicle. They help drivers see better in fog, rain, or snow. As a result, they emit less light. The brightness of the fog lights is measured in lumens. For the Peugeot 508 fog lights, the lumen output for halogen bulbs is typically around 1000-1500 lumens per bulb. LED fog lights are brighter, with lumen outputs ranging from 2000-4000 lumens per bulb.
Regular Cleaning:
When maintaining Peugeot 508 fog lights, it is important to clean the lights regularly. Over time, dirt, debris, and grime can accumulate on the fog lights, making them less effective. As a result, users should use a soft cloth or sponge with mild soap and water to wipe the fog lights clean. This practice will ensure they maintain optimal visibility.
Check Alignment:
Another maintenance tip for the Peugeot 508 fog light is to check the alignment. Proper alignment is essential to ensure the fog lights are effective and do not blind other road users. This is because, unlike headlights, fog lights are designed to shine low to the ground and illuminate the road surface directly in front of the vehicle. To check the alignment, park the vehicle on a flat surface about 10-25 feet from a wall. Experts advise that the vehicle owner or driver should adjust the fog lights so that the light beam is level and does not go beyond the wall.
Bulb Replacement:
It is also necessary to replace the fog light bulbs when they start to dim or burn out. This will help maintain optimal brightness and visibility. When replacing the bulbs, it is essential to use original equipment manufacturer (OEM) replacement bulbs. This is because OEM bulbs are designed to work perfectly with the Peugeot 508 fog lights and offer the same performance and durability.
Avoid Touching Bulbs:
When replacing the fog light bulbs, it is essential to avoid touching the glass part of the bulb with bare hands. This is because the oils from the skin can cause the bulb to dim or burn out quickly. If touching is inevitable, use gloves or a paper towel to handle the bulb.
Electrical Connections:
When maintaining the fog lights, it is important to inspect the electrical connections. Loose or corroded connections can cause the fog lights to flicker or not work. It is recommended that drivers check the connections periodically to ensure they are tight and free from rust or corrosion.

Peugeot 508 fog lights are not the same as regular car lights. They require special care. Only trained mechanics should handle complex problems. But, some minor issues are easy to fix. With the right tools and knowledge, anyone can attempt a DIY.
Before attempting a DIY, find out if the problem is simple. If it is a bulb replacement, DIYers can go ahead. Read the car's manual to find the correct bulb type. Turn off the fog light switch. Open the fog light cover. A flat screwdriver can help. Remove the old bulb carefully. It might be wet inside. Wear gloves. Only touch the new bulb with gloves. Insert the new bulb gently. Do not touch the glass. It can cause the bulb to burst. Close the cover and fog light switch.
For other issues, do a DIY only if knowledgeable about car lights. If not, consult a mechanic. It will save time and avoid further damage. Doing repairs the wrong way can be costly. Ensure the car is parked in a safe, well-lit place. A garage is ideal. A roadside fog light repair can be risky. Other cars may move fast and cause accidents.

Q1: What is a Peugeot 508 fog light?
A1: The Peugeot 508 fog light is a car light found in a Peugeot 508 car model. Its work is to light the road when the driver is facing either mist or fog. The light helps the driver to see the road clearly.
Q2: How does a fog light switch work?
A2: A fog light switch controls the fog light. To turn on the fog light, the switch has to be turned on and held in either the first or second position. The first position switches on the front fog light, while the second position switches on the rear fog light.
Q3: How are Peugeot 508 fog lights upgraded?
A3: Upgrading the Peugeot 508 fog lights can be done by simply changing the bulb to a better one. The halogen bulb can be changed to an LED bulb. This will give the fog light a brighter and whiter glow.
